Bahrain has announced one more death from coronavirus, a 48-year-old male citizen.
The death toll has soared to 121, the lowest in the GCC. It’s the fourth death recorded today from COVID-19.
The MOH expressed its condolences to the family of the deceased.

The total cases have driven to 34,560, which means that over 87 percent of the confirmed cases have recovered from the virus. Currently, there are 4,119 active cases.
The active cases are seen to be dropping, as part of the preventive measures taken by the kingdom.

There are 113 COVID-19 cases receiving treatment, of which 45 are in a critical condition.
So far the country has conducted 693,539 tests, as per the government statics.
